In this Research Article, we reported a eutectic electrolyte consisting of ethylene glycol (EG) and ZnCl2. A deep eutectic electrolyte (ZnCl2-4EG) composed of EG and ZnCl2 for dendrite-free zinc anodes has been reported in a previous study by Mun and co-workers,1 which was not cited in our article. In Ref. [1], the electrolyte was prepared in air and therefore contained a certain amount of water. The residual water led to an anodic limit of ≈1.24 V vs. standard hydrogen electrode (SHE), which is close to the anodic limit of water (≈1.23 V vs. SHE). In our article, the DES-4 eutectic electrolyte is almost free of water, and has an anodic limit of ≈2.39 V vs. SHE.
